Deadline: 27 June 2014
EuropeAid is seeking proposals for Fostering Innovative Forms of Philanthropy in Local Communities to Support Sustainability of Civil Society in Croatia. The mission of this programme is to promote innovative forms of philanthropy as a support mechanism to the sustainability of CSOs and support to individual philanthropy.
Major Objectives:
- encouraging foundations and associations to get actively involved in fostering innovative forms of philanthropy in local communities
- building community based CSOs’ capacities and infrastructure for philanthropic activities
- developing multi-sector partnerships aimed at addressing social problems in the community and society
- promoting individual and corporate philanthropy in Croatia
Grant request can be made up to EUR 500.000 for the duration of not be lower than 12 months nor exceed 24 months.
Eligibility criteria:
- be a legal person
- be non-profit-making
- be non-governmental organisations (or formal networks of non-governmental organisations) of the following legal status: associations , business associations , trade unions , foundations , and legal entities of religious communities
- be established in a Member State of the European Union or a Member State of the European Economic Area, The former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ia, Turkey, Albania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Montenegro, Serbia, including Kosovo
- be directly responsible for the preparation and management of the action with the co-applicant(s) and affiliated entity(ies), not acting as an intermediary
